Family tree Servaes, Maastricht/Venlo/Straelen/Neuss/Düsseldorf » Wilhelm "Willi" Servaes (1880-1941)

Personal data Wilhelm "Willi" Servaes 

  • Nickname is Willi.
  • He was born on November 21, 1880.Source 1
  • Occupations:
    • Meister-Metzger.
    • Telephon-Adressbuch für das Deutsche Reich Düsseldorf 1907.
      1158 Servaes, Wilh., Metzger, Klosterstr. 3.
    • starting 1898 Stellverteter des Vorsitzenders des Schiedsgericht der Fleischerinnung.Source 2
  • Facts:
    • (vermelding) Adreßbuch der Stadt Düsseldorf 1933.Source 3
      Innungen und deren gewerbliche Vereinigungen:
      Darmverwertung:
      Vortsitzender: Willi Servaes, Klosterstraße 3
    • (vermelding) Verzeichniss der in Düsseldorf am Sedanfeste 1895 lebenden Mitkämpfer von 1848/49, 1864, 1866 und 1870/71.Source 4
      2347. Servaes, Wilh. Metzgermeister, Klosterstr. 3, 1866, Inf.-Regt. 57
  • Resident: Klosterstrasse 3, Düsseldorf.Source 5
  • He died on May 1, 1941 in Düsseldorf, Deutschland, he was 60 years old.Source 6
    Oorzaak: Chron. Nephritis. Bronchopneumonie
    Tijdstip: 23:45
  • A child of Wilhelm Anton Servaes and Maria Anna Catharina Heuter
